Masked Visual Actions for Unified World Modeling

First seen · 7/22/2026, 12:00 PMLatest activity · 7/22/2026, 12:00 PM

This paper introduces Masked Visual Actions, a pixel-space control interface that represents actions as partially revealed trajectories of arbitrary entities in a video. Revealing robot motion turns a video model into a forward dynamics predictor for scene responses, while revealing desired object motion enables inverse modeling of robot behavior. A single checkpoint is fine-tuned on 15 hours of masked examples from real videos and simulation. The authors report strong visual fidelity and controllability across diverse scenes and embodiments, plus utility for imagined rollouts, model-based planning, and manipulation policy evaluation.
